NEW PN: 286581TL0A; JP

Old codes
286581AN5A 286581AN4A 286583YP0A
42.59 EUR
inc. VAT 21%
Out of production
Delivery 7 days
PN 286581AN1A
Make NISSAN

No description found

No specification found

0 Updated